Journal: :Applied microbiology 1967
S A Morse R A Mah

The rapid microtiter technique was investigated as a means of facilitating the detection of staphylococcal enterotoxin B. With this technique, many samples were assayed simultaneously, and readable results were obtained in 3 hr. Other advantages of this method, in addition to speed, were the small quantity of reactants used, ease of reading, and reproducibility.

Journal: :Journal of bacteriology 1969
J Gruber G G Wright

The ammonium sulfate coprecipitation technique of Farr was applied in a study of the purified enterotoxins of Staphylococcus aureus. Ammonium sulfate coprecipitation of iodine-131-labeled enterotoxins A, B, and C, with the use of a 1.6 m concentration of (NH(4))(2)SO(4), revealed differences in the antigen-binding capacity of normal and immune rabbit sera for the enterotoxins. 2010
William D. Cornwell Thomas J. Rogers

Staphylococcus aureus enterotoxins have immunomodulatory properties. In this study, we show that Staphylococcal enterotoxin A (SEA) induces a strong proliferative response in a murine T cell clone independent of MHC class II bearing cells.
